MXE-1500

Intel Celeron N3160/ N3060 SoC Fanless Embedded Computer

The successor to ADLINK’s best-selling MXE-1300 Series, the MXE-1500 offers richer I/O interfaces, and more flexible I/O configurations in the same compact enclosure.

Intel Celeron (Braswell) processors, Intel’s last generation of CPU to support Windows 7, power the MXE-1500 to a 90% increase in image processing capabilities over the previous generation, and support three independent displays, altogether delivering an unequaled price/performance ratio and making the MXE-1500 an ideal choice for industrial automation applications and mass transit operators.

Technical specifications

System

Processor Quad Core Celeron N3160 1.6GHz, up to 2.24GHz (MXE-1501)
Dual Core Celeron N3060 1.6GHz, up to 2.48GHz (MXE-1502)
Memory 2x DDR3L SODIMM up to 8GB

I/O Interface

Display Port 1x DisplayPort
VGA 1x VGA
Optional graphic output 18/24bit single-ch LVDS or DisplayPort
Ethernet 3x GbE
Serial COM1/2: RS-232,
COM3/4: RS-232/422/485
COM5/6: RS-232/422/485 (optional), shared location w/ optional DisplayPort
USB 2x USB3.0 + 4x USB2.0 + 1x internal USB 2.0 dongle
DIO 4 DI + 4 DO
Audio Mic-in / Line-out
2x 2W into 8Ω amplifier (optional)
Mini PCIe 1x full size Mini PCIe
USIM 1x USIM

Manageability

Security TPM 2.0 (optional)
WDT Watch Dog Timer supported by SEMA
SEMA SEMA 3.5

Power Supply

DC Input 6-36VDC
AC Input Optional 90 W AC/DC adapter

Storage Device

SATA Storage 1x 2.5" SATA
CompactFlash 1x CFast

Mechanical

Dimension 210 (W) x 170 (D) x 53 (H) mm
Weight 1.5 Kg (3.31 lbs)
Mounting VESA 100
DIN rail (optional)

Environmental and physical specifications

Operating Temperature Standard:
0°C to +50°C (32˚F to 122˚F)

Extended temperature option (w/ industrial SSD/CFast):
-20°C to +70°C (-4˚F to 158˚F)
Storage Temperature -40°C to 85°C (-40°F to 185°F)
Humidity ~95% @ 40°C (104°F) (non-condensing)
Vibration Operating: 5 Grms, 5-500 Hz, 3 axes (w/SSD)
Operating: 0.3 Grms, 5-500 Hz, 3 axes (w/ HDD)
Shock Operating 100G, half sine 11 ms duration w/ SDD;
Operating 20G, half sine 11ms w/ HDD
ESD Contact ±6KV, Air ±10KV
EMC EN61000-6-4/-2, CE/FCC Class A (Class B by request)
Safety UL[by CB]
